Starogard County (Polish: powiat starogardzki) is a county in Pomeranian Voivodeship, Poland. Capital is in Starogard Gdański. County is inhabited by the Kociewiacy ethnic group.
Population: 121,650 (2005), including 50,000 in Starogard Gdański.
Area: 1345 km², including 25 km² in the town of Starogard Gdański.

The county consists of 14 communes:
- 3 municipal communes, towns: Czarna Woda, Skórcz and Starogard Gdański,
- 1 rural-municipal commune: Skarszewy (includes the town of Skarszewy),
- 10 rural communes: Bobowo, Kaliska, Lubichowo, Osieczna, Osiek, Skórcz, Smętowo Graniczne, Starogard Gdański, Zblewo.
